Then Researchers Became Interested In Retatrutide.

Retatrutide doesn’t just flip one switch.

It interacts with three different signaling pathways that researchers are studying.

It’s like finding three control panels instead of one.

The room gets quieter.

But there’s still one group of people yelling.

Then Enter Cagrilintide.

Imagine discovering the master volume knob.

It doesn’t replace the control panels.

It works alongside them.

Researchers study cagrilintide because it acts on amylin receptors, a completely different pathway than the three retatrutide targets.

Now you’re not adjusting one part of the room.

You’re coordinating four different systems that all influence how loud the room feels.

That’s Why Researchers Became Interested In The Blend.

Not because it’s “more.”

Because it’s different.

Retatrutide and cagrilintide don’t study the exact same pathways.

Researchers are interested in whether combining those different signaling systems may produce different effects than studying either alone.
